What is the Residential Levelized Billing Plan Agreement?
The Residential Levelized Billing Plan Agreement is a financial document offered by Oconee EMC, aimed at assisting residential and farm consumers under Rate Schedule 'R' in stabilizing their electricity payments. This agreement averages monthly electricity costs, benefiting those who may experience fluctuations due to varying usage patterns throughout the year.
This billing arrangement is specifically designed for non-seasonal residential consumers and farm consumers. To qualify, applicants must demonstrate a good payment history and continuity of service, which underscores the importance of maintaining a responsible payment record.

Who Should Use the Residential Levelized Billing Plan Agreement?
This agreement is tailored for specific consumer types, particularly non-seasonal residential and farm consumers. Continuous service and a positive payment history are essential eligibility requirements, making this plan especially relevant for Georgia residents utilizing Oconee EMC services.

Who is eligible to sign the Residential Levelized Billing Plan Agreement?
Both the residential consumer and a cooperative representative must sign the agreement. Eligibility typically requires a good payment history and at least one year of continuous service.
What should I prepare before filling out the form?
Gather your personal information, including your social security number, Oconee EMC account number, and details of the cooperative representative that will co-sign the agreement.
